中文摘要:
      本文对产于黄岩五部和天台大岭口这二个银铅锌矿床中的菱锰矿,开展了成分、x射线衍射、红外光谱及差热曲线方面的研究,指出:这二个矿床中的菱锰矿,其MnCO3、FeCO3、MgCO3和CaCO3的平均分子比分别为0.936、0.035、0.007和0.022,明显地表现出高锰低铁贫镁钙的特征;在微量元素方面,以相对贫Co(Co/Ni平均值为0.457)富Ba(Ba/Sr平均值为15.014)为特征;x射线衍射、红外光谱和差热曲线与标准菱锰矿的特征基本一致。这些特征是由浙东地区银铅锌矿床的成矿特点和介质的Eh-pH变化特点所引起的。
英文摘要:
      In this paper, the mineralogic characteristics of rhodochrosite from two Ag-Pb-Zn deposits,Huangyan Wubu and Tiantai Dalingkou, are discussed by carrying on the study of X-ray diffraction, infrared spectroscopy and differential thermal method.The mean molecular percent of MnCO3、FeCO3,MgCO3 and CaCO3 for the rhodochrosite from the two deposits are 0.936, 0.035,0.007 and 0.022 respectively. These numbers indicate obviously that the rhodochrosite possesses high content of Mn,low content of Fe, and lack of Mg and Ca. As for the trace elements, the relative low Co content (the mean Co/Ni ration=0.457) and high Ba content (the mean Ba/Sr ratio=15.014) are occurred. X-ray powder diffraction data, IR spectra and differential thermal curves generally coincide with that of the typical rhodochrosrte. The characteristics are due to the minerogenetic laws of the Ag-pb-Zn deposits in eastem Zhejiang Province and the changing value of Eh-pH in the medium.
